1) If the police ask in your consent to search your property and also you refuse, they might decide to acquire a warrant so as to get the job performed. If you recognize you’re innocent of wrongdoing and really feel you don’t have anything to hide, by giving consent you waive the detectives’ must get a warrant. If proof is discovered that might incriminate you, however, you are unable to reverse your choice.

The duty of police to tell suspects of their Part 10(b) rights was firmly established by the Supreme Court of Canada in R. v. Bartle in 1994, where the accused was arrested for alleged impaired driving and the police failed to tell him of his proper to contact counsel on the time of arrest.
